Cryptocurrency users, especially those trading on South Korea’s Upbit platform, face a critical development. Upbit has announced a temporary **Upbit OM suspension** of deposits and withdrawals for Mantra (OM). This measure begins promptly at 3:00 a.m. UTC on November 5. Furthermore, the exchange cites a crucial **Mantra network upgrade** as the reason for this temporary halt. Consequently, users holding or trading OM on Upbit must pay close attention to this announcement.

Specifically, the key details are:
- Asset Affected: Mantra (OM)
- Exchange: Upbit (South Korea)
- Action: Temporary suspension of deposits and withdrawals
- Start Time: 3:00 a.m. UTC on November 5
- Reason: Mantra network upgrade
This proactive step by Upbit aims to safeguard user funds. It also ensures a smooth transition for the Mantra network. All traders must heed this notice to prevent potential transaction issues.
